CHARLOTTE, N.C. (February 13, 2020) - The College of Central Florida's Devyn Howard was named NJCAA Division I Softball Player of the Week on Wednesday.

Howard, a sophomore third baseman from Tarpon Springs, Fla., batted .435 (20-for-46) with 10 runs scored, eight doubles, one triple, two home runs, 28 RBI and two stolen bases in 13 games during the voting period. 

Howard has helped the Patriots to a 13-0 start to the season.

She hit safely in 11 of the 13 games and had six multi-hit and six multi-RBI games. Most notably, she was 2-for-3 with a home run and five RBI vs. Miami Dade and 3-for-3 with three doubles and six RBI vs. State College of Florida. 

Howard was named the NJCAA Region 8 Softball Player of the Week on Tuesday.
